29 AIREDALE is a very large extended detached house of 188m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995, which could now be worth an estimated £350,135. It was last sold for £210,000 in October 2012, which was around 17% below the average October 2012 detached price in the East Suffolk local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was July 2014,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

29 AIREDALE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the East Suffolk local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 29 AIREDALE sales between March 1997 and October 2012 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2004 sale was for 19%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 19% below the HPI over time, until the October 2012 sale, where it rises to 17%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 17% below the HPI.

What might 29 AIREDALE be worth now?

29 AIREDALE might now be worth an estimated £350,135.

This is based on house price inflation of 66.7%, between October 2012 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the East Suffolk local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 66.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 29 AIREDALE of £210,000 on 12th October 2012. For the value to have increased from £210,000 to £350,135 over the thirteen years and eight months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 29 AIREDALE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the East Suffolk local authority area.
  • The October 2012 sale price of £210,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 29 AIREDALE has not materially changed since October 2012.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

How Large is 29 AIREDALE?

29 AIREDALE is 188m², which includes one extension, according to the EPC inspection conducted in July 2014. This puts it in the largest 10% of detached houses houses in Lowestoft,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ses houses by size in Lowestoft, and where 29 AIREDALE lies on this distribution: 96% of detached houses houses are smaller than 29 AIREDALE, and 4%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Lowestoft.

29 AIREDALE: Plot and Title Map

29 AIREDALE sits on a plot of roughly 0.107 of an acre, or 433m². The below map shows the location of 29 AIREDALE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 29 AIREDALE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
